CmmToLlvm: Don't aliasify builtin LLVM variables
Our aliasification logic would previously turn builtin LLVM variables into aliases, which apparently confuses LLVM. This manifested in initializers failing to be emitted, resulting in many profiling failures with the LLVM backend. Fixes #22019.
